    Well there's Seaguar, Seaguar, and Seaguar...Tatsu if budget isn't an issue, Invizx if it is...The only one I can't speak for that I've heard really good things about is Sunline...Everybody that's tried it seems to be very fond of it....If budget is a serious issue the BPS fluoro is another a lot of guys seem to have some luck with...Although I haven't tried the new Vicious, the old stuff was garbage...Stiff as a board, tons of memory, and very little knot strength for me anyway

    Quote Originally Posted by MagikSmallie View Post
    What are the differences between Sunline Sniper and Shooter?
    Sniper is a little stiffer than Shooter. I use the Sniper for heavier line apps and Shooter for lighter line apps and on spinning gear. Hope that helps.
